Garnet James Buell 1927–1991 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 5 SEP 1927

Birth Location: Smithfalls, Lanark, Ontario, Canada

Death Date: 30 JAN 1991

Death Location: Hillcrest Cemetery, Smiths Falls, Lanark, Ontario, Canada

Father: Harold Buell

Mother: Lucinda Lett

Spouse(s):

Children(s):

In 1927, Garnet James Buell entered the world in Smithfalls, Lanark, Ontario, Canada, born to Harold Buell And Lucinda Lett. Garnet James Buell passed away in 1991 in Hillcrest Cemetery, Smiths Falls, Lanark, Ontario, Canada.
